Millions of individuals in the United States are affected by chronic pain, which poses a significant concern for public health. According to the CDC, around 20.5-21.8% of adults in the U.S. experienced chronic pain between 2019-2021, emphasizing the necessity for effective pain management centers to offer crucial relief to patients.

However, doctors not only face the critical task of managing chronic pain but also encounter the complexities of navigating medical coding and billing procedures. Keeping abreast of the ever-changing landscape of CPT codes, insurance verification, and claim acceptance can be overwhelming. Therefore, outsourcing pain management billing service is always a preferred choice for physicians providing pain management services.

To effectively navigate pain management practice, one must possess a comprehensive understanding of the distinct codes and guidelines associated with each specialty. For instance, acupuncture clinics must be highly knowledgeable in acupuncture-specific CPT codes and guidelines, while physical therapy and chiropractic clinics should acquaint themselves with the applicable codes and guidelines pertaining to their respective procedures and treatments.     Pain management medical billing refers to the process of billing and coding for medical services related to the diagnosis and treatment of pain conditions. It involves submitting claims to insurance companies, ensuring accurate coding, and maximizing reimbursement for pain management practices.

    Pain management practices often provide a wide range of services, including injections, procedures, medications, and physical therapy. Specialized billing ensures that these services are accurately documented and coded to optimize revenue while remaining compliant with healthcare regulations.

    Outsourcing pain management billing can save time and resources, reduce billing errors, improve cash flow, and keep up with evolving billing and coding regulations. It allows healthcare providers to focus on patient care while experts handle billing tasks.

    Look for a billing company with experience in pain management billing, a proven track record of accuracy and compliance, transparent pricing, and excellent customer service. References and testimonials can also help in the selection process.

    Common challenges include staying up-to-date with changing regulations, managing denials and claim rejections, coding accurately for complex procedures, and ensuring timely payment from insurance companies.

    A pain management billing service can streamline the revenue cycle by optimizing the billing process, reducing claim denials, improving collection rates, and providing regular financial reports to help you manage your practice's finances effectively.

    Yes, many pain management billing services offer patient billing and collections as part of their services. They can send out patient statements, answer patient billing inquiries, and assist in collecting outstanding balances.

    Choose a billing company that adheres to strict security and privacy regulations, such as HIPAA (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act). They should have robust data encryption, access controls, and data protection measures in place.

    Billing services may charge a percentage of collections, a flat fee per claim, or a monthly fee. The cost can vary based on the complexity of your practice and the services you require. Make sure to clarify the pricing structure before signing a contract.
